For NC solenoid valves, it's closed when the coil is de-energized, i.e., when there’s no electric current flowing via it. This means that the orifice is closed, and no medium can flow by means of it. Once the solenoid is powered, the present flows by the coil and energizes it. This creates an electromagnetic area with a resultant pressure that pushes the plunger upwards to beat the resistive spring drive.

Valves are basic devices for controlling gas and liquid circulate, and adding solenoids enables them to be remotely controlled and automated. Valves come in lots of sizes and styles and are a basic sort of mechanical part utilized in all method of equipment, equipment, and processes. Valves can physically be opened or closed utterly, and generally to positions in-between, to manage the availability, circulation, and strain of gasses and liquids.


An AC solenoid system has a larger magnetic force accessible at a better stroke than a comparable DC solenoid system. The characteristic stroke vs. Fig. Eight, illustrate this relationship. The present consumption of an AC solenoid is determined by the inductance. With increasing stroke the inductive resistance decreases and causes a rise in present consumption. This means that at the instant of de-energization, the present reaches its maximum value. Stainless-steel and Numan-mount type solenoids. A preferred direct-appearing solenoid valve is the 2-manner valve that can be selected within the normally open or normally closed configuration. In a normally open solenoid configuration, a spring supplies the force to hold the seal away from the seat of the orifice, holding the circulation path open as lengthy as the coils are de-energized. Making use of electrical power creates an electromagnetic power that pushes the seal in direction of the seat and stops circulate in the specified path. The inverse is true for a usually closed circuit. Energizing the solenoid coil lifts the seal from the orifice seat, opening the flow path and permitting fluid circulation. Direct-performing valves have a compact design because the actuation mechanism is inside the valve physique. The move rates and allowable stress limits for fluids passing via direct-acting solenoid valves rely upon the sizes of the orifices and the magnetic drive that the solenoid supplies.
